Background: To define changes in AMI case rates, patient demographics, cardiovascular comorbidities, treatment approaches, in-hospital outcomes, and the economic burden of COVID-19 during the pandemic. Methods: We conducted a multicenter, observational survey with selected hospitals from three medical universities in Tehran city. A data collection tool consisting of three parts. The first part included socio-demographic information, and the second part included clinical information, major complications, and in-hospital mortality. Finally, the third part was related to the direct medical costs generated by AMI in COVID-19 and non-COVID-19 patients. The study cohort comprised 4,560 hospitalizations for AMI (2,935 for STEMI [64%] and 1,625 for NSTEMI [36%]). Results: Of those hospitalized for AMI, 1,864 (76.6 %) and 1,659 (78 %) were male before the COVID-19 outbreak and during the COVID-19 era, respectively. The length of stay (LOS), was significantly lower during the COVID-19 pandemic era (4.27 ± 3.63 vs 5.24 ± 5.17, p = 0.00). Results showed that there were no significant differences in terms of patient risk factors across periods. A total of 2,126 AMIs were registered during the COVID-19 era, with a 12.65 % reduction (95 % CI 1.5-25.1) compared with the equivalent time in 2019 (P = 0.179). The risk of in-hospital mortality rate for AMI patients increased from 4.9 % in 2019 to 7.0 % in the COVID-19 era (OR = 1.42; 95 % CI 1.11-1.82; P = 0.004). Major complications were registered in 9.7 % of cases in 2020, which is higher than the rate of 6.6 % reported in 2019 (OR = 1.46, 95 % CI 1.11-1.82; P = 0.000). Total costs in hospitalized AMI-COVID patients averaged $188 more than in AMI patients (P = 0.020). Conclusion: This cross-sectional study found important changes in AMI hospitalization rates, worse outcomes, and higher costs during the COVID-19 periods. Future studies are recommended to examine the long-term outcomes of hospitalized AMI patients during the COVID-19 era.

OBJECTIVES: Ankylosing spondylitis (AS) is a chronic progressive and debilitating form of arthritis with associated extra-articular features including uveitis, intestinal and lung apical inflammation and psoriasis. Putative associations between AS and neurologic disorders has been relatively overlooked. The purpose of this study is to assess the link between AS and major neurologic disorders and whether treatment with Tumor-Necrosis-Factor inhibitors (TNFi) has an impact on that association. METHODS: A retrospective cross-sectional study was carried out based on the Clalit Health Services (CHS) computerized database. AS patients were compared to age- and gender-matched controls with respect to the proportion of Alzheimer's disease (AD), Parkinson's disease (PD), epilepsy, and multiple sclerosis (MS). The impact of AS therapy (biologic vs conventional therapy) was assessed as well. RESULTS: 4082 AS patients and 20,397 age- and gender-matched controls were identified. AS was associated with a higher prevalence of AD (odds-ratio(OR) 1.46 [95%Confidence-interval(CI) 1.13-1.87], p = 0.003), epilepsy (OR 2.33 [95%CI 1.75-3.09] p < 0.0001) and PD (OR 2.75 [95%CI 2.04-3.72], p < 0.0001), whereas no statistically significant association was found for MS. Association with PD remained significant in the multivariate analysis (OR 1.49 [95%CI 1.05-2.13],p = 0.027). Within AS patients, the use of TNFi (OR 0.10 [95%CI 0.01-0.74], p = 0.024) were associated with a lowered risk of developing AD. CONCLUSION: AS is positively associated with AD, PD, and epilepsy but not MS. AS patients treated with TNFi have lower rates of AD.

Background: According to the World Bank, the medical tourism industry in 2016 generated more than $100 billion revenue turnover for the destination countries. This study aims to investigate the developmental requirements of medical tourism industry in Iran to identify sustainable development strategies within this sector. Methods: The present study was an applied-analytical study performed in a cross-sectional manner. A total of 25 experts, including policy experts, decision-makers, and managers with over 10 years of experience in the health system and familiar with the process of attracting medical tourists from foreign countries were asked to compare options for the development of the medical tourism. Expert opinions were analyzed using a fuzzy analytical hierarchy process using the open-source R Studio software. Results: Out of the 5 items included in the questionnaire, the criterion of "government policy making and related entities" was ranked the first in terms of importance and prioritization for medical tourism development (0.249) through attracting domestic and foreign investments followed by advertising and marketing (0.241). Also, the criteria of "destination characteristics" and "facilities and status of service capacities with 0.111 and 0.185 weights had the lowest weight among the 5 items, respectively. Conclusion: In general, governments play a key role in marketing and promoting the nascent medical tourism industry. Experts in the field believe that the role of government, policy and decision-makers in medical tourism can be an advantage for its prosperity and development.

A growing body of literature on the 2019 novel coronavirus (SARS-CoV-2) is becoming available, but a synthesis of available data has not been conducted. We performed a scoping review of currently available clinical, epidemiological, laboratory, and chest imaging data related to the SARS-CoV-2 infection. We searched MEDLINE, Cochrane CENTRAL, EMBASE, Scopus and LILACS from 01 January 2019 to 24 February 2020. Study selection, data extraction and risk of bias assessment were performed by two independent reviewers. Qualitative synthesis and meta-analysis were conducted using the clinical and laboratory data, and random-effects models were applied to estimate pooled results. A total of 61 studies were included (59,254 patients). The most common disease-related symptoms were fever (82%, 95% confidence interval (CI) 56%-99%; n = 4410), cough (61%, 95% CI 39%-81%; n = 3985), muscle aches and/or fatigue (36%, 95% CI 18%-55%; n = 3778), dyspnea (26%, 95% CI 12%-41%; n = 3700), headache in 12% (95% CI 4%-23%, n = 3598 patients), sore throat in 10% (95% CI 5%-17%, n = 1387) and gastrointestinal symptoms in 9% (95% CI 3%-17%, n = 1744). Laboratory findings were described in a lower number of patients and revealed lymphopenia (0.93 × 109/L, 95% CI 0.83-1.03 × 109/L, n = 464) and abnormal C-reactive protein (33.72 mg/dL, 95% CI 21.54-45.91 mg/dL; n = 1637). Radiological findings varied, but mostly described ground-glass opacities and consolidation. Data on treatment options were limited. All-cause mortality was 0.3% (95% CI 0.0%-1.0%; n = 53,631). Epidemiological studies showed that mortality was higher in males and elderly patients. The majority of reported clinical symptoms and laboratory findings related to SARS-CoV-2 infection are non-specific. Clinical suspicion, accompanied by a relevant epidemiological history, should be followed by early imaging and virological assay.

Background: Visit length is an indicator that can be used to assess patients' satisfaction of the health care services. In recent years, some studies have focused on the mean visit time in Iran. This study aimed at determining the average visit time in Iran by performing a systematic review and meta-analysis. Methods: In this study, Embase, PubMed/MEDLINE, Scopus, ISI/Web of Science databases, and Google Scholar search engine, as well as Iranian national databases/thesauri, such as MagIran, SID, and Irandoc were used. These databases were searched from their inception until September 2017. The quality of retained studies was assessed using the STROBE checklist. Average visit length was reported using stochastic model with 95% confidence interval (CI). I2 and Q tests were used to assess the heterogeneity of the studies. A sensitivity analysis was conducted to ensure the stability of the results. Results: After searching the scholarly databases and reviewing the articles based on inclusion and exclusion criteria, 6 studies were finally selected. Based on the random model, the mean visit time was 4.89 minutes in Iran, ranging from 4.66 to 5.12 minutes (p=0.82). The most time visit in specialists belonged to psychiatrists with 9.12 (7.28 to 10.96) minutes (p=0.19) and the lowest belonged to internists with 3.59 (2.24 to 4.95) minutes (p=0.00), respectively. Conclusion: The average visit time in Iran was estimated to be 4.89 minutes. To increase patients' satisfaction and provide a better disease treatment and management in Iran, the following suggestions could be helpful: properly distributing physicians across the country, reducing waiting lists, and implementing the use of guidelines to standardize the visit time.

Background: Societies are characterized by evolving health needs, which become more challenging throughout time, to which health system should respond. As such, a constant monitoring and a periodic review and reformation of healthcare systems are of fundamental importance to increase the efficiency and effectiveness of healthcare services delivery, equity, and sustainable funding. The establishment of President Rouhani's government in Iran, on May 5, 2014, the settlement of the new Ministry of Health and Medical Education administration (MoHME) and the need for change in the provision of healthcare services has led to the "Health System Transformation Plan" (HSTP). The aim of the current investigation was to critically evaluate the health transformation plan in Iran. Methods: Strengths, Weaknesses, Opportunities and Threats (SWOT) analysis enables to identify and assess the strengths and weaknesses within an organization or program, as well as the threats and opportunities outside the given organization or program. To identify SWOT of the HSTP in Iran, all articles concerning this program published in scholarly databases as well as in the gray literature were systematically searched. Subsequently, all factors identified at the first round were thematically classified into four categories and for reaching consensus on this classification, the list of points and factors was sent to 40 experts - policy- and decisionmakers, professors and academicians, health department workers, health activists, journalists. Results: Thirty-four subjects expressed comments on classification. Incorporating their suggestions, the SWOT analysis of Iran's HSTP was revised, finalized and then performed. Conclusion: HSTP in Iran, like many of the initiatives that have been recently introduced and not fully implemented, have various challenges, difficulties and pitfalls that health policymakers need to pay attention to. Interacting with criticisms, taking into account public opinion and strengthening the plan can make the project more effective, and it can be anticipated that in the future, better conditions in the health sector will be achieved.

Background: Nosocomial infections represent a serious public health concern worldwide, and, especially, in developing countries where, due to financial constraints, it is difficult to control infections. This study aimed to review and assess the prevalence of nosocomial infections in Iran. Methods: Different databases were searched between January 2000 and December 2017. To determine the pooled prevalence, the stochastic DerSimonian-Laird model was used, computing the effect size with its 95% confidence interval. To examine the heterogeneity among studies, the I2 test were conducted. The reporting of observational studies in epidemiology (STROBE) checklist was used to assess the methodological quality of observational studies. To further investigate the source of heterogeneity, meta-regression analyses stratified by publication year, sample size and duration of hospitalization in the hospital were carried out. Results: 52 studies were included. Based on the random-effects model, the overall prevalence of nosocomial infection in Iran was 4.5% [95% CI: 3.5 to 5.7] with a high, statistically significant heterogeneity (I2=99.82%). A sensitivity analysis was performed to ensure the stability results. After removing each study, results did not change. A cumulative meta-analysis of the included studies was performed based on year of publication and the results did not change. In the present study, a high rate of infections caused by Klebsiella pneumoniae (urinary tract, respiratory tract, and bloodstream infections) was found. Conclusion: Preventing and reducing hospital infections can significantly impact on reducing mortality and health-related costs. Implementing ad hoc programs, such as training healthcare staff on admission to the hospital, may play an important role in reducing infections spreading.

The recent outbreak of Chikungunya virus in Italy represents a serious public health concern, which is attracting media coverage and generating public interest in terms of Internet searches and social media interactions. Here, we sought to assess the Chikungunya-related digital behavior and the interplay between epidemiological figures and novel data streams traffic. Reaction to the recent outbreak was analyzed in terms of Google Trends, Google News and Twitter traffic, Wikipedia visits and edits, and PubMed articles, exploiting structural modelling equations. A total of 233,678 page-views and 150 edits on the Italian Wikipedia page, 3,702 tweets, 149 scholarly articles, and 3,073 news articles were retrieved. The relationship between overall Chikungunya cases, as well as autochthonous cases, and tweets production was found to be fully mediated by Chikungunya-related web searches. However, in the allochthonous/imported cases model, tweet production was not found to be significantly mediated by epidemiological figures, with web searches still significantly mediating tweet production. Inconsistent relationships were detected in mediation models involving Wikipedia usage as a mediator variable. Similarly, the effect between news consumption and tweets production was suppressed by the Wikipedia usage. A further inconsistent mediation was found in the case of the effect between Wikipedia usage and tweets production, with web searches as a mediator variable. When adjusting for the Internet penetration index, similar findings could be obtained, with the important exception that in the adjusted model the relationship between GN and Twitter was found to be partially mediated by Wikipedia usage. Furthermore, the link between Wikipedia usage and PubMed/MEDLINE was fully mediated by GN, differently from what was found in the unadjusted model. In conclusion-a significant public reaction to the current Chikungunya outbreak was documented. Health authorities should be aware of this, recognizing the role of new technologies for collecting public concerns and replying to them, disseminating awareness and avoid misleading information.
